Common Questions
Is the Trane HUS1570 compatible with variable speed motors?
Yes, this housing is designed to accommodate the torque and airflow variations of both ECM motors and standard PSC motors, provided the mounting bracket matches the HUS1570 footprint.
Does this assembly include the blower wheel and motor?
This SKU represents the blower housing only. The wheel, motor, and mounting hardware must be sourced separately or reused from the existing assembly.
What are the signs that a blower housing needs replacement?
Inspect the housing for structural cracks, excessive rust that compromises the seal, or physical deformation caused by wheel failure. Any breach in the scroll will result in significant CFM loss.
